@font-face{font-family:'revolution-icon';src:url("../fonts/revolution-icon.eot?-f9vuda");src:url("../fonts/revolution-icon.eot?#iefix-f9vuda") format("embedded-opentype"),url("../fonts/revolution-icon.woff?-f9vuda") format("woff"),url("../fonts/revolution-icon.ttf?-f9vuda") format("truetype"),url("../fonts/revolution-icon.svg?-f9vuda#revolution-icon") format("svg");font-weight:normal;font-style:normal}@font-face{font-family:'revolution-icon-extension';src:url("../fonts/rev-icons-extension.eot?-f9vuda");src:url("../fonts/rev-icons-extension.eot?#iefix-f9vuda") format("embedded-opentype"),url("../fonts/rev-icons-extension.woff?-f9vuda") format("woff"),url("../fonts/rev-icons-extension.ttf?-f9vuda") format("truetype"),url("../fonts/rev-icons-extension.svg?-f9vuda#revolution-icon") format("svg");font-weight:normal;font-style:normal}[class^="rev-"],[class*=" rev-"]{font-family:'revolution-icon';speak:none;font-style:normal;font-weight:normal;font-variant:normal;text-transform:none;line-height:1;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.rev-icon1:before{content:"\e600"}.rev-icon2:before{content:"\e601"}.rev-icon3:before{content:"\e602"}.rev-icon4:before{content:"\e603"}.rev-icon5:before{content:"\e604"}.rev-icon6:before{content:"\e605"}.rev-icon7:before{content:"\e606"}.rev-icon8:before{content:"\e607"}.rev-icon9:before{content:"\e608"}.rev-icon10:before{content:"\e609"}.rev-icon11:before{content:"\e60a"}.rev-icon12:before{content:"\e60b"}.rev-icon13:before{content:"\e60c"}.rev-icon14:before{content:"\e60d"}.rev-icon15:before{content:"\e60e"}.rev-icon16:before{content:"\e60f"}.rev-icon17:before{content:"\e610"}.rev-icon18:before{content:"\e611"}.rev-icon19:before{content:"\e612"}.rev-icon20:before{content:"\e613"}.rev-icon21:before{content:"\e614"}.rev-icon22:before{content:"\e615"}.rev-icon23:before{content:"\e616"}.rev-icon24:before{content:"\e617"}.rev-icon25:before{content:"\e618"}@font-face{font-family:'rev-icon';src:url("../fonts/rev-icon-nw.eot?-zf79qg");src:url("../fonts/rev-icon-nw.eot?#iefix-zf79qg") format("embedded-opentype"),url("../fonts/rev-icon-nw.woff?-zf79qg") format("woff"),url("../fonts/rev-icon-nw.ttf?-zf79qg") format("truetype"),url("../fonts/rev-icon-nw.svg?-zf79qg#icomoon") format("svg");font-weight:normal;font-style:normal}[class^="icon-"],[class*=" icon-"]{font-family:'rev-icon';speak:none;font-style:normal;font-weight:normal;font-variant:normal;text-transform:none;line-height:1;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.icon-icon-linkedin:before{content:"\e679"}.icon-rise-of-the-rest:before{content:"\e600"}.notransition{-o-transition:none !important;-ms-transition:none !important;-moz-transition:none !important;-webkit-transition:none !important;transition:none !important}.csl-theme .header .header-container .custom-mobile-btn{display:none;height:100%;position:absolute;top:0;right:80px;background:#eb3223 url(../img/headoverlay_bg.png);color:white;cursor:pointer;font-family:'Dosis Semibold';cursor:default;line-height:80px;padding:0 10px;height:80px}@media(max-width:1024px){.csl-theme .header .header-container .custom-mobile-btn{display:block;font-size:14px}}.csl-theme .header .header-container .header-logo{height:80px !important}@media(min-width:1024px){.csl-theme .header .header-container .main-navigation .menu ul{justify-content:space-between}}@media(min-width:1024px){.csl-theme .header .header-container .main-navigation .menu ul li:nth-child(3){padding-right:10rem}}@media(min-width:1024px){.csl-theme .header .header-container .main-navigation .menu ul li:nth-child(4){padding-left:10rem}}@media(min-width:1024px){.csl-theme .header .header-container .main-navigation .menu ul li a{padding:2rem 1rem;font-family:'Dosis Light'}.csl-theme .header .header-container .main-navigation .menu ul li a:hover{color:#eb3223}}.csl-theme .header .header-container .main-navigation .menu ul li.custom-btn{background:#eb3223 url(../img/headoverlay_bg.png);position:relative}@media(max-width:1024px){.csl-theme .header .header-container .main-navigation .menu ul li.custom-btn{display:none}}.csl-theme .header .header-container .main-navigation .menu ul li.custom-btn a{color:white;cursor:pointer;font-family:'Dosis Semibold';cursor:default}@media(max-width:1024px){.csl-theme .header .header-container .main-navigation .menu ul li.blank-item{display:none}}@media(min-width:1024px){.csl-theme .header .header-container .main-navigation .menu ul:not(.sub-menu){padding-left:0}}.csl-theme .header .header-container .main-navigation ul li a:hover{color:#eb3223}@media(max-width:1024px){.csl-theme .header .header-container .toggle-menu{display:block;right:1rem}}.csl-theme .header.sticky{background:transparent;position:fixed;z-index:111;top:0}.csl-theme .header.sticky .header-container{background:0;position:inherit}@media(max-width:1024px){.csl-theme .header.sticky .header-container{background:rgba(38,35,35,0.8)}}.csl-theme .header.sticky .header-container .header-logo{margin:auto;border:0;background:0}@media(min-width:1024px){.csl-theme .header.sticky .header-container .header-logo{position:absolute;left:0;top:0}}@media(min-width:1024px){.csl-theme .header.sticky .header-container .header-logo .logo{top:350px;max-width:800px;max-height:600px;width:100%;left:50%;transform:translate(-50%,-50%);padding:0 50px;-webkit-transition:all .5s;-moz-transition:all .5s;-ms-transition:all .5s;-o-transition:all .5s;transition:all .5s;margin:0}}@media only screen and (min-width:1025px){.csl-theme .header.sticky .header-container{display:block;flex:none}}.csl-theme .header.sticky.fixed-menu .header-container{position:relative;background:rgba(38,35,35,0.8)}@media(min-width:1024px){.csl-theme .header.sticky.fixed-menu .header-container{height:93px !important}}.csl-theme .header.sticky.fixed-menu .header-container .header-logo{background:0}.csl-theme .header.sticky.fixed-menu .header-container .header-logo .logo{top:50%;max-width:140px;padding:0}.footer{display:flex;align-items:center;justify-content:center;flex-wrap:wrap;flex-direction:row;background:white;position:relative}.footer p{color:white}.footer .footer-row{width:50%;min-height:350px;display:flex;align-items:center;flex-wrap:wrap}@media(max-width:992px){.footer .footer-row{width:100%}}.footer .footer-row:first-child{background:#eb3223 url("../img/headoverlay_bg.png");align-items:center;justify-content:center;display:flex;position:relative}@media(max-width:992px){.footer .footer-row:first-child{min-height:150px}}.footer .footer-row:first-child:before{content:"";position:absolute;width:20px;height:122px;border-style:solid;border-width:61px 0 61px 20px;border-color:transparent transparent transparent #eb3223;left:100%;top:50%;z-index:99;margin-top:-61px}@media(max-width:992px){.footer .footer-row:first-child:before{transform:rotate(90deg);left:0;right:0;margin:0 auto;top:initial;bottom:0;top:65%;margin-top:0}}.footer .footer-row:first-child:after{content:"";position:absolute;width:20px;height:122px;background:url("../img/arrow_leftpoint.png ") no-repeat left top;left:100%;top:50%;z-index:100;margin-top:-61px}@media(max-width:992px){.footer .footer-row:first-child:after{transform:rotate(90deg);left:0;right:0;margin:0 auto;top:initial;bottom:0;top:65%;margin-top:0}}.footer .footer-row:first-child h3{font-size:60px;text-transform:uppercase;font-family:'Dosis Light';font-weight:200;text-align:center}@media(max-width:992px){.footer .footer-row:first-child h3{font-size:45px}}.footer .footer-row:first-child h3 strong{font-family:'Dosis Light';font-weight:200}.footer .footer-row:nth-child(2){position:relative;background:url("../img/overlay_bg.png") repeat scroll 0 0 rgba(0,0,0,0)}@media(max-width:992px){.footer .footer-row:nth-child(2){padding-top:40px}}.footer .footer-row:nth-child(2) strong{font-family:'Dosis Semibold';font-weight:200;font-size:30px}@media(max-width:768px){.footer .footer-row:nth-child(2) .footer-content{align-items:center;justify-content:center;flex-direction:column}}.footer .footer-row:nth-child(2) .footer-col{padding:0 40px}@media(max-width:768px){.footer .footer-row:nth-child(2) .footer-col{min-height:initial;text-align:center}}.footer .footer-row:nth-child(2) .footer-col:first-child{padding-left:50px}@font-face{font-family:'Proxima Nova Rg';src:url("../fonts/ProximaNova-Regular.woff2") format("woff2"),url("../fonts/ProximaNova-Regular.woff") format("woff");font-weight:normal;font-style:normal;font-display:swap}@font-face{font-family:'Dosis Semibold';src:url("../fonts/Dosis-SemiBold.woff2") format("woff2"),url("../fonts/Dosis-SemiBold.woff") format("woff");font-weight:600;font-style:normal;font-display:swap}@font-face{font-family:'Dosis Regular';src:url("../fonts/Dosis-Regular.woff2") format("woff2"),url("../fonts/Dosis-Regular.woff") format("woff");font-weight:normal;font-style:normal;font-display:swap}@font-face{font-family:'Dosis Light';src:url("../fonts/Dosis-Light.woff2") format("woff2"),url("../fonts/Dosis-Light.woff") format("woff");font-weight:300;font-style:normal;font-display:swap}@font-face{font-family:'Dosis Extra Light';src:url("../fonts/Dosis-ExtraLight.woff2") format("woff2"),url("../fonts/Dosis-ExtraLight.woff") format("woff");font-weight:200;font-style:normal;font-display:swap}h1{font-family:'Dosis Semibold'}h1 strong{font-family:'Dosis Semibold'}h2,h3,h4,h5,h6{font-family:'Dosis Regular'}h2 strong,h3 strong,h4 strong,h5 strong,h6 strong{font-family:'Dosis Regular'}p{font-family:'Proxima Nova Rg';color:#4d4d4d}.csl-theme body .visible-nav{height:initial;left:initial;position:initial;overflow:initial !important;top:initial;width:initial}.csl-theme body .regular-content-section article p{font-size:23px;text-align:justify}@media(max-width:768px){.csl-theme body .regular-content-section article p{font-size:16px}}.csl-theme body .regular-content-section.content-button{padding-top:20px;padding-bottom:50px}.regular-content-section.heading-title{background:#eb3223 url("../img/headoverlay_bg.png");position:relative}.regular-content-section.heading-title .container{max-width:100%;width:100%}.regular-content-section.heading-title .container h1{color:white;text-transform:uppercase;font-family:'Dosis Light';font-weight:200;max-width:750px;margin-left:auto;margin-right:auto}@media(max-width:992px){.regular-content-section.heading-title .container h1{font-size:45px;line-height:50px}}.regular-content-section.heading-title .container h1 strong{font-family:'Dosis Light'}.regular-content-section.heading-title:before{content:"";position:absolute;width:20px;height:122px;border-style:solid;border-width:61px 0 61px 20px;border-color:transparent transparent transparent #eb3223;left:0;right:0;margin:0 auto;top:100%;z-index:10;margin-top:-55px;transform:rotate(90deg)}.regular-content-section.heading-title:after{content:"";position:absolute;width:20px;height:122px;background:url("../img/arrow_leftpoint.png ") no-repeat left top;left:0;right:0;margin:0 auto;top:100%;z-index:11;margin-top:-55px;transform:rotate(90deg)}@media(max-width:1024px){.hero .banner-two-thirds{min-height:530px}}.hero .banner:before{background:url("../img/overlay_bg.png") repeat scroll 0 0 rgba(0,0,0,0);content:"";height:100%;left:0;position:absolute;top:0;width:100%;z-index:100;opacity:.8}.hero .banner .image-container{background-attachment:fixed}.csl-theme body .regular-content-section article ul li{font-family:'Proxima Nova Rg';font-size:23px;margin-bottom:30px}@media(max-width:768px){.csl-theme body .regular-content-section article ul li{font-size:15px}}.csl-theme body .regular-content-section article a{color:#eb3223;font-family:'Proxima Nova Rg';font-size:23px}@media(max-width:768px){.csl-theme body .regular-content-section article a{font-size:15px}}.csl-theme body .regular-content-section article a:hover{text-decoration:underline}.csl-theme body .regular-content-section.content-button article a{border:#eb3223 solid 2px;color:#eb3223;background:0;border-radius:50px;margin:0 auto;padding:10px;text-transform:uppercase;text-align:left;text-decoration:none;font-family:"Dosis Semibold",sans-serif;height:auto;font-size:18px;line-height:35px;display:block;max-width:400px;text-align:center;position:relative;padding-right:40px}.csl-theme body .regular-content-section.content-button article a:before{content:'';position:absolute;right:15px;top:10px;content:"\e610";font-family:'revolution-icon';color:#eb3223}.csl-theme body .regular-content-section.content-button article a:hover{background:#eb3223;color:white}.csl-theme body .regular-content-section.content-button article a:hover:before{color:white}.columns-block{padding-top:0}@media(max-width:992px){.columns-block .row{flex-direction:column}}.columns-block .flex-col{border-bottom:1px solid #e5e5e5}@media(max-width:992px){.columns-block .flex-col{width:100%}}.columns-block .flex-col:first-child{border-right:1px solid #e5e5e5}@media(max-width:768px){.columns-block .flex-col:first-child{border-right:0;margin-bottom:0}}.columns-block .flex-col figure{margin:0;height:350px;position:relative}.columns-block .flex-col figure img{object-fit:cover;width:100%;height:100%;object-position:center}.columns-block .flex-col figure:before{content:"";position:absolute;width:20px;height:122px;border-style:solid;border-width:61px 0 61px 20px;border-color:transparent transparent transparent #FFF;left:0;right:0;margin:0 auto;bottom:0;margin:0 auto -55px;z-index:10;transform:rotate(-90deg)}.columns-block .flex-col article{float:left;width:100%}.columns-block .flex-col article h5{text-align:center;font-size:30px;margin:30px 0;text-transform:uppercase;font-family:'Dosis Light';font-weight:200;font-size:45px;line-height:55px}.columns-block .section-title{text-transform:uppercase;margin-bottom:80px;background:#eb3223 url(../img/headoverlay_bg.png);position:relative;color:white;padding:50px 0;font-size:60px;line-height:66px;font-family:'Dosis Light';font-weight:200}@media(max-width:992px){.columns-block .section-title{font-size:45px;line-height:50px}}.columns-block .section-title:before{content:"";position:absolute;width:20px;height:122px;border-style:solid;border-width:61px 0 61px 20px;border-color:transparent transparent transparent #eb3223;left:0;right:0;margin:0 auto;top:100%;z-index:10;margin-top:-55px;transform:rotate(90deg)}.columns-block .section-title:after{content:"";position:absolute;width:20px;height:122px;background:url("../img/arrow_leftpoint.png ") no-repeat left top;left:0;right:0;margin:0 auto;top:100%;z-index:11;margin-top:-55px;transform:rotate(90deg)}.columns-block .content-inner{padding:0 40px}@media(max-width:767px){.columns-block .content-inner{padding:0}}.columns-block .content-inner article p{text-align:justify}.columns-block.corporate{padding:80px 0}.columns-block.corporate ul{list-style:none}.columns-block.corporate ul li{margin-bottom:30px}.columns-block.corporate ul li:before{content:"\e610";font-family:'revolution-icon';color:#eb3223}.columns-block.corporate ul li a{font-family:'Proxima Nova Rg';color:#4d4d4d}.columns-block.corporate ul li a:hover{color:#eb3223}.columns-block.corporate .flex-col{border-bottom:0}@media(min-width:1024px){.accordion-section .container{max-width:960px}}.accordion-section .accordion{padding:0 60px}@media(max-width:767px){.accordion-section .accordion{padding:0}}.accordion{border:0}.accordion p{font-size:23px}@media(max-width:768px){.accordion p{font-size:16px}}.accordion>.card{border:0;border-bottom:1px solid #4d4d4d !important;border-radius:0}.accordion>.card .card-header{font-family:'Dosis Light';text-align:center;font-size:32px;background:transparent;border-bottom:1px solid transparent;color:#eb3223;position:relative}@media(max-width:1024px){.accordion>.card .card-header{font-size:28px}}@media(max-width:768px){.accordion>.card .card-header{font-size:24px}}.accordion>.card .card-header:after{position:relative;left:5px;content:"\e610";font-family:'revolution-icon';color:#eb3223;font-size:19px;top:-5px}.accordion>.card .card-header:hover{color:#ff3323;text-decoration:none}.accordion>.card .card-body{color:#4d4d4d;font-size:23px}@media(max-width:768px){.accordion>.card .card-body{font-size:16px}}.accordion>.card .card-body h4{text-align:center}.accordion>.card .card-body a{color:#eb3223;font-family:'Proxima Nova Rg';font-size:23px}@media(max-width:768px){.accordion>.card .card-body a{font-size:16px}}.accordion>.card .card-body a:hover{color:#ff3323;text-decoration:underline}.accordion>.card .card-body ul{padding:0;margin:0 0 20px}.accordion>.card .card-body ul li{list-style:none;text-align:center;margin-bottom:20px}footer a:hover{color:#eb3223}